▷ Only 24h Left: National Sales Manager Faade Installations...
17 hours ago
Sheffield
Job Description National Sales Manager Faade Installations Job Title: National Sales Manager Faade Installations Industry Sector: Fenestration, Curtain Wall, Windows, Facade, Cladding, Weather Proofing, EDPM, Glazing, Doors, Shop Front, Architectural Glass Systems, Aluminium Systems, Structural G...